middle full-stack developer
with 3+ years of experience as a full-stack developer
Send CVmust be skills
- HTML 5 (Slim, Haml), CSS3 (SCSS, flex boxes, grids)
- Experience with CSS3 Animations, Media Queries, Responsive web design
- Experience in cross-browser and cross-platform development
- JavaScript (ES6, CoffeScript, JQuery)
- At least minimal experience with one of the frameworks: ReactJS, AngularJS, Vue
- Strong knowledge of Ruby, Ruby on Rails
- Experience Nginx, Puma, Passenge
- Experience with a high load systems
- Experience with Web Sockets (ActionCable)
- Experience with databases: MySQL, PostgreSQL, DynamoDB
- Experience with AWS services (Route53, S3, EC2, LoadBalancer, ElasticBeanstalk, CloudFront, RDS, Lambda, etc.);
- Console / CLI / SDK
- Unix as a main prod env
- Communicate in English as a primary
- language (B1+)
would be a plus
- Basic knowledge of NodeJS/Python
- Experience with GraphQL (Apollo Client)
- Experience with message brokers (RabbitMQ, Sidekiq)
- Experience with browsers extensions (Chrome, Safari)
- Be passionate at least in one product domain-sports, big data, AI, gaming
responsibilities
- Building new products from scratch, with the latest version of Ruby, Rails, ReactJS, etc
- Development of APIs, data scraping modules and serverless microservices
- Setup and improvement of current AWS infrastructure
- Development of browser extensions
- Development of non-trivial web pages with text texturing, multi-layered blocks, masks, CSS3 animations etc
- Development of new ReactJS components
- Bug fixing of existing components
- Participation in tasks estimations
- Communication with the team
our stack
- Most of the projects build on the Ruby on Rails framework
- Git, GitHub
- Web servers: Puma, Passenger, Nginx
- Core of frontend: ReactJS, HTML5, CSS3, vanilla JS, jQuery, CoffeeScript
- Cloud Computing: AWS (Route53, S3, EC2, CloudFront, RDS, Lambda, etc.)
- DB: MySQL, PostgreSQL, DynamoDB
- Optionally we use: Web Sockets, GraphQL, RabbitMQ, etc
our methodology
- Scrum
our benefits
- Assistance with the legalisation of stay
- Opportunity to grow and develop your skillset
- Flexible hours
- Ability to work from home
- Company social events
- Fitness program
- Private health insurance
- All kinds of snacks provided
join our team!
join our team!
request demo
US
160 West State Street
Trenton, NJ 08608-1102
+1 609 278 1807
Trenton, NJ 08608-1102
+1 609 278 1807
EU
Topiel 23
00-342 Warszawa, Poland
+48 606 830 113
00-342 Warszawa, Poland
+48 606 830 113